MinterEllison’s inclusive culture is built on nearly two centuries of enduring client relationships and expertise in tackling complex, cross‑border issues with commercial pragmatism Cobbora Solar Farm is a 700MWac solar farm with a battery energy storage system in NSW which has now been acquired by Pacific Partnerships. Once developed, Cobbora Solar Farm will be one of the largest solar farms in Australia with an approximate footprint of up to 1600MGh of BESS to supply energy on demand. This adds to Pacific Partnerships extensive portfolio of renewable energy projects across Australia. They will manage the construction, investment, delivery and operations of the solar farm working with CIMIC Group’s subsidiary, UGL in matters of development and maintenance of the solar farm and BESS. Pacific Partnerships were assisted by Minter Ellison throughout this acquisition. Commenting on the deal Partner, Paul Paxton, said: “The solar farm forms part of CIMIC Group’s strategic commitment to Australia’s energy transition, and will contribute to the Australian Government’s target of net zero emissions by 2050.
